subrutina dlog_query

Finalidad

Consulte el registro de sucesos de diagnóstico para ver si hay entradas que coincidan con un criterio de entrada.

Sintaxis


#include <diag/diag_log.h>
int dlog_query(query_log *criteria, query_results *results) 

Descripción

La subrutina dlog_query consulta en el registro de sucesos de diagnóstico las entradas que coinciden con un criterio de entrada.

Parámetros

Elemento Descripción
criterios Criterios utilizados para buscar el registro de sucesos de diagnóstico. Los campos no utilizados deben establecerse en 0.
results Estructura que contiene un puntero a una lista de entradas que coinciden con los criteria.Entries de entrada. Las entradas se devuelven ordenadas por número de secuencia de registro de sucesos de diagnóstico (el más alto primero).

Valor de retorno

La subrutina dlog_query devuelve uno de los valores siguientes:
Elemento Descripción
0 Si es satisfactorio
-1 No se ha podido abrir el registro de sucesos de diagnóstico
-2 Se ha producido un error al leer el registro de sucesos de diagnóstico
-3 Los criterios de búsqueda no son válidos
-4 No se ha podido asignar la memoria